A week ago, we reported that a third-party extension developed by a programmer, Dominic Maas, that allow you to synced your Google Chrome browsing history to the Windows timeline was forced to go down due to trademark issues, which made many users feel sorry. But the good news is that today this extension has been relaunched, just modified the name Timeline Support.

This extension allows you to:

  • Sync your browsing history to Windows Timeline, access it at a later date or on another device with the same Microsoft Account.
  • Adjust how many seconds you have to be on a page before it’s stored in Windows Timeline (by default, 8 seconds).
  • Continue browsing on another device quickly by ‘pushing’ your current active tab to other devices sharing the same Microsoft Account.
